Output 68512d2d51ea218e40f38169b22ade907320053a213078f7c61f83d685b14585:0

value
4071020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 747f5f96159508ef19816021203e2ffbaa7c9a3c OP_EQUAL
address
3CJztrUvWLJwsf5aoaPDV8xKg7yELAMs7t
transaction
68512d2d51ea218e40f38169b22ade907320053a213078f7c61f83d685b14585
spent
true